A peptide is a short chain of amino acids (typically 2 to 50) linked by chemical bonds (called peptide bonds). A longer chain of linked amino acids (51 or more) is a polypeptide. The proteins manufactured inside cells are made from one or more polypeptides. WebJul 14, 2024 · A denatured protein cannot do its job. Amino acids are joined by peptide bonds. A peptide bond is a type of covalent bond between the carboxyl group of one amino acid and the amino group of another amino acid. Human hair is a protein fiber mainly composed of alpha – keratin which is a sulfur-rich protein and is a key player in defining the physical and chemical properties of hair. 1-2. Just like all other proteins, keratin is a large organic polymer made by small monomers called amino acids.

WebProteins have different shapes and molecular weights; some proteins are globular in shape whereas others are fibrous in nature. For example, hemoglobin is a globular protein, but collagen, found in our skin, is a fibrous protein. Protein shape is critical to its function, and this shape is maintained by many different types of chemical bonds.
